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Архив Flasher.ru > Работа над сайтом > Macromedia Director

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ему  
Старый 17.09.2004, 01:17
B0Bka вне форума Посмотреть профиль Отправить личное сообщение для B0Bka Найти все сообщения от B0Bka
  № 1  
B0Bka
 
Аватар для B0Bka

Регистрация: May 2004
Сообщений: 136
Отправить сообщение для B0Bka с помощью ICQ
По умолчанию Director #text & html

как отображать html в обычном #text ?

Старый 18.09.2004, 13:06
Злые тапки вне форума Посмотреть профиль Отправить личное сообщение для Злые тапки Найти все сообщения от Злые тапки
  № 2  
Злые тапки

Регистрация: Sep 2004
Сообщений: 25
По умолчанию Да он просто импортируется

Начиная с Д7 html можно импортировать.

Сам сейчас разбираюсь. Пока споткнулся только на поддержке русского языка.
__________________
Чтобы писать программы голова не нужна, нужны только руки и клавиатура (с)

Старый 18.09.2004, 13:45
B0Bka вне форума Посмотреть профиль Отправить личное сообщение для B0Bka Найти все сообщения от B0Bka
  № 3  
B0Bka
 
Аватар для B0Bka

Регистрация: May 2004
Сообщений: 136
Отправить сообщение для B0Bka с помощью ICQ
а можно ли отображать html если я его беру из внешнего xml файла (текст английский)

Старый 18.09.2004, 15:31
Злые тапки вне форума Посмотреть профиль Отправить личное сообщение для Злые тапки Найти все сообщения от Злые тапки
  № 4  
Злые тапки

Регистрация: Sep 2004
Сообщений: 25
Так ты xml или html хочешь отображать?

По поводу xml где-то видел xml parser'ы. Скорее вчего это будут внешние экстры.

А с html все проще:
- создаешь мембер типа "text" (например "tipaText")
- говоришь member("tipaText").filename = "@:text/MyHtmlPage.html"

и он импортируется

Были косяки с русским текстом - найдено решение:
- в html тексте пишешь тэг <font face="Arial CYR"> и все хорошо.

Главное писать имя шрифта так как он написан в директоре (Dreamweaver усердно пишет что-то типа <font face="Arial, Helvetica, sans-serif"> это надо заменять)

Только непонятно как вставлять картинки в html код, возможно это вообще не реализовано (в director 7 это упущение написано прямым текстом в мануале)
__________________
Чтобы писать программы голова не нужна, нужны только руки и клавиатура (с)

Старый 18.09.2004, 15:52
B0Bka вне форума Посмотреть профиль Отправить личное сообщение для B0Bka Найти все сообщения от B0Bka
  № 5  
B0Bka
 
Аватар для B0Bka

Регистрация: May 2004
Сообщений: 136
Отправить сообщение для B0Bka с помощью ICQ
нет немного не так понял,

для парсинга xml использую (флэшевый объект):

qXML = newObject("XML");
setCallback(qXML, "onLoad", symbol("loadqXML"), 0);
qXML.ignoreWhite = true;
qXML.load("data/questions.xml");

потом данные (тексты, пути к картинкам/mp3) из xml файлов загоняю в массивы (для того чтобы удобно было дальше работать).
так вот в этих текстах используются html теги (выделения/ссылки) (во флэше то это все без проблем работало а в директоре нет)

p.s. и еще один вопросик: не работал в Директоре с компонентами TextInput, List?
как обработать событие TextInput.change?

Старый 18.09.2004, 16:41
Злые тапки вне форума Посмотреть профиль Отправить личное сообщение для Злые тапки Найти все сообщения от Злые тапки
  № 6  
Злые тапки

Регистрация: Sep 2004
Сообщений: 25
Нашел мульку

Пишешь member("someTextMember").html = "<html>тра-та-та</html>"

В тэге <html> ессено пишешь все что хочешь.
__________________
Чтобы писать программы голова не нужна, нужны только руки и клавиатура (с)

Старый 18.09.2004, 18:47
B0Bka вне форума Посмотреть профиль Отправить личное сообщение для B0Bka Найти все сообщения от B0Bka
  № 7  
B0Bka
 
Аватар для B0Bka

Регистрация: May 2004
Сообщений: 136
Отправить сообщение для B0Bka с помощью ICQ
По умолчанию respect!

да! спасибо, вот это мне и надо было!

Создать новую тему   Часовой пояс GMT +4, время: 22:13.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Вык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 22:13.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.